Welcome to Mrs. Perret's Science!
Sixth Grade
Course Description:

This full-year course provides an introduction to four areas of study in the field of science. The first area is the nature of science and technology, in which students will study what science is and how it is useful in their everyday lives. The second area is geology, which includes the study of earthquakes, volcanoes, plate tectonics, minerals and rocks. The third area is environmental science, in which students will study three primary environmental issues: resource use, population growth and pollution. The final area of the course is astronomy, in which students will study the solar system and its many parts.
